Output 62c589e4e06c79a81b1f20d1ce88ad264adb590f0a14ec9a5156399e016d800a:0

value
223542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a4d51f006783119b65fac4102c6585072157193 OP_EQUAL
address
3FktcNtWX2TXFubz8qBq1MqHc5fN1eDvTD
transaction
62c589e4e06c79a81b1f20d1ce88ad264adb590f0a14ec9a5156399e016d800a
spent
true